Submarine School, HMS Dolphin was the Royal Navy's principal submarine training establishment at Gosport, Hampshire, serving as the focal point for instruction in submarine operations, tactics, and engineering from the early 20th century until its closure in 1998. The school supported the Royal Navy's Submarine Service through world wars, Cold War patrols, and technological transitions involving diesel-electric and nuclear propulsion. Its programs intersected with institutions such as the Admiralty, Royal Naval College, Greenwich, and shipbuilding yards on the River Clyde.
